Suitable for a single child

It's crucial to pick the right model of pushchair for you and your family. Whether you choose a single or double pushchair, you should check out the finer points like seat padding and the adjustable handlebar. It is also important to ensure whether the pushchair is safe to use from birth, has an option for lying flat seating and includes the option of a carrycot.

There are pushchairs that come in a variety of colours and styles to meet all tastes. You can get a pushchair in a floral design or a metallic style which is more modern. Accessories for pushchairs like raincover, pram cover and hood can make the pushchair more comfortable. Often these accessories are included with the pushchair. However, you should check to make sure they're compatible with the particular model.

The majority of pushchairs come with an foot brake pedal that can be pressed by the parent for additional safety and security. The brake can be found on the left or the right side of the rear wheel and is easily accessible to the parent. Depending on the model of pushchair, it may also have a bumper bar, hood or padded seat, as well as an extendable handlebar.

The best single travel stroller single pushchairs should be designed for use in everyday life and should be light, sturdy and easy to fold. They should be robust enough to handle all kinds of terrains, from urban pavements and bumpy grass. They should also be fitted with puncture-proof tires to limit the possibility that sharp stones or glass will cause damage.

Many single pushchairs come with the option of a carrycot connected to the chassis of the pushchair, making it suitable for babies as young as six months. The carrycot can be removed easily and connected to the chassis to store at home. This is an excellent option if you're planning to have a second child shortly after the first.

Convertible pushchairs are another option that can be used as a single or double. They require adapters to convert from one to a twin. They can be expensive, but offer an excellent flexibility for families expecting a second child.

It is suitable for a second child

If you're already a mother to a single child or planning to welcome a new baby soon, it's important to select the best pushchair for your expanding family. The right pushchair must be comfortable, light and easy to move particularly when you're carrying a large toddler and a baby. Look for a lightweight compact model with a handlebar that is adjustable to is sized to your height. It is crucial to have a reversible seat with hood, handlebar and seat that can be adjusted to your baby's requirements.

It can be difficult to select the ideal pushchair for two children, but there are many options to choose from. A tandem buggy is a great option if you wish to let your children interact with each other while you're on the move. These types of pushchairs tend to be larger than single-seaters and could be a bit harder to maneuver through tight spaces or on public transport. However, they're great for parents who want their children to sit side by side.

There are many options available for twins, close-in-age children or children who are young and toddler. These include side-by-side strollers that place one behind the other and rear-facing strollers with seats that face eachother. A lot of single and double buggies are convertible and start out as a single buggy, with the possibility of adding a second carrycot or seat unit at a later time. This is a great option for parents who are expecting a second child in the near future.

Some twin prams, like the Roma Gemini, are designed to be used with both a newborn and an infant by simply securing a newborn cocoon (PS59 each) to either side of the frame to create an enclosed lying-flat area for your young children. The innovative frame expands wide enough to accommodate an additional seat, and is then used as a mono or double pushchair based on your needs.

Check that the pushchair fabrics can be washed in the machine, particularly when you intend to take it on long walks in the mud. If not, you can usually clean your area using water and mild soap. Some prams have wheels that are easily removed and thoroughly cleaned, making it easier to access the dirtiest areas. Also, make sure that the mudguards and wheel covers are water-proof.

The fabrics on pushchairs vary from one manufacturer to the next It is therefore recommended to read the instructions for washing. In the majority of cases, you can machine wash the seat. If you don't, a damp cloth with gentle soap and a spot clean is enough. Avoid using solvents and aggressive cleaning agents since they could harm the fabric or cause shrinkage. Attach the seat back to the frame when dry and wipe down all plastic or metal components. If the wheels are removable, a regular spray with silicone lubricant will help keep them looking new.

When buying a double stroller, select one that can be used as a travel unit with the car. You can attach the car seat of your child onto the chassis so you can go away without disturbing them. Some double buggies work with infant car seats or carrycots. They can be used for both toddlers and infants.
